Not sure what you mean by "hate of tradition", but if you meant "traditional marriage" we've already long since abandoned that. Arranged marriages solely for the purpose of procreation and to establish rules of inheritance and form family alliances are long gone. The new definition of marriage is about love and life-long partnership (as opposed to the husband essentially owning the wife) and those ideas are not at all traditional. Nor are they in any way incompatible with gay marriage.
Currently the majority of people still oppose gay marriage, so I will turn your own question back on you--who stands to benefit from mass hysteria? Look to where the bulk of the hysteria is coming from to find your answer. It's not those who support gay marriage who have made the biggest deal out of this--it's those who oppose it and they are the same one's who have the most to gain from bringing this issue to the forefront.
As far as I'm concerned marriage is primarily a religious sacrament and as such Government has no business licensing (either to allow or forbid) it in the first place. In the time of our founding fathers there was no such thing as Government marriage licenses--some words spoken over you by a preacher and a notation in the family Bible and you was hitched. .Government didn't start licensing marriage until after the civil war and the entire reason was to prevent inter-racial marriage. The courts overturned that prohibition against the popular will of the people, and now the same is happening with gay marriage.
